eRiCdWoNg, That sucks about your car man... Nah the cubby's are not used the middle one will hold 1 optima battery and im replacing the front battery with an optima too (yellow tops).
The box is made out of MDF so that's why the cubbys wented used for air space.
DNAST1, I used less than one box of dynamat for the rear. 1 box of the Xtreme dynamat = 36sq ft. I think I had 2 sheets left over. Not sure how many sq ft each sheet is would have to check the box again but a rough guess would say I used approx 25sq ft of this stuff.

the whole purpose of the yellow tops is so you can play it with the car off... So if that's not the case why spend the exta money on 2 yellows at all? Interstate makes great batts that are a lot cheaper.
for that matter, running a dual batt is a waste all together...
Re: System Install in C5 Part2... PICS PICS (Metal_Wulf)
The yellow top is a deep cycle battery meant for high current draw. Not just to be ran with the car off.. I have called and spoken to optima on this matter.
Running 2 batteries is definetly NOT a waste. With this much system nearly 2000 watts if I had one battery everytime the bass hit the lights would dim. This takes a heavy load on a regular battery and will kill it shortly. Thus the need for a Yellow tops deep cycling. By adding a second battery the system will not fade out like that there will be more power and the bass wont drop off.
